Business Analyst, Healthcare
Inmar IntelligenceAbout the role
The Business Analyst demonstrates the ability to understand customer needs, analyze business processes, and prepare functional requirements for new systems and updates to existing systems. Over time, this position may convert into an Associate Product Manager role as opportunities become available.
Primary Accountabilities:
Product Support and Development (40%):
- Partner with Product and Engineering teams to evaluate the efficacy of experiments and product launches, assessing impact on user behavior and business outcomes.
- Draft clear and concise business requirements, user stories, and technical product documentation.
- Collaborate with end users to develop test data, conduct system testing, and verify accuracy of results.
- Support cross-functional enablement by creating and maintaining user documentation and training materials.
- Educate internal teams on product area vision and evolving industry trends, including AI, ML, API, and healthcare data practices
Business Analysis and Execution (40%):
- Research and collaborate with project teams to identify current and future business needs.
- Perform workflow analysis and business process reengineering, ensuring alignment with organizational objectives.
- Define processing logic, translate business requirements into detailed functional design documents, and ensure delivery aligns with defined needs.
- Facilitate cross-application meetings to capture requirements and align stakeholders.
- Participate in vendor selection processes and support RFP development as needed.
Continuous Improvement & Experimentation (20%)
- Build and track KPIs to measure product success, adoption, and business value. Monitor project status, follow up on roadblocks, and ensure timelines remain current.
- Stay informed of healthcare industry regulations, stakeholders, and market trends.
- Share insights and learnings to drive innovation and continuous improvement in the product development
lifecycle.
Facilitate key workflows through rapid experimentation of products and capabilities.
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ree required
- 1-3 years of experience in business analysis, project management, or related roles; or any equivalent combination of experience and training that provides the required knowledge, skills, and abilities needed to complete the major responsibilities/essential functions of the position
Preferred Qualifications:
- Familiarity with agile and Kanban methodologies and tools like Jira or ADO.
- Knowledge of the healthcare industry.
- Strong analytical skills with experience using tools such as Excel, SQL, or Looker for data analysis and reporting.
